Subject: Audit-log viewer v2 is out

Hi all — welcome aboard if you're new! The Larkspan audit-log viewer just shipped to staging. Main changes: filter by actor, export to CSV, and the timeline no longer freezes past 10k events. Contractors get read-only access by default; ping the platform team if you need more. Poke around and file anything weird in the tracker. The build you should be testing is this one.

build token for kagaf-hahof: htk14_9d3d4d26d7d8de

## Account Recovery: Nightfill Scheduler

The Nightfill scheduler runs our nightly data backfills out of the Quarrystone cluster. If the service account gets locked — usually after three failed token refreshes — you'll need to recover it before the 02:00 window, or backfills skip a day and downstream reports drift.

Open the recovery console, select the nightfill-svc account, and choose "Passphrase recovery." Approval from the on-duty lead is implied for new joiners; just note it in the shift log. Enter the passphrase exactly as written below.

strongbox words: sorir-belvan-rusix-ulays-ralmir-praix-eliir-tamax-praael-druael-julir-tamius-jorir

Migration step 4 — Updating your plugin for Sheetfall v3

The CSV import wizard now calls your column-mapping hook before type inference, not after, so don't rely on inferred types in the hook anymore. Also, row validators are async now — return a promise or the wizard will hang on step two. Test against the sandbox profile first. The sandbox wizard runs with the configuration shown below.

config for tajof-tajef:
ralael:
  pin: 3468
  metrics_host: metrics.ralael.lumicsys.internal
  tenant: casath
  seal: seal_c325d9c6